Basketball Accessories

Jul 10, 2018

If you are going to play the part, then you are going to have to look the part. Besides having game, a baller must have the right accessories!

Basketball Accessories - Headbands

An NBA player wearing a headband. Headbands have been a must-wear for a lot of NBA players for the past half-decade. Players such as LeBron James, Allen Iverson, Carmelo Anthony and Ben Wallace are famous for sporting the headband. Not surprisingly, players in college, high school, elementary school and on the playgrounds have adopted the look. Headbands are cheap and come in almost every color imaginable. They retail from $5 to $15 US.

Basketball Accessories - Armbands

An NBA player wearing an arm band. Whether you sweat a lot or not, it is a good idea to rock an arm band when you play. Arm bands are another fashion statement within basketball culture. Typically, those players who wear headbands usually wear arm bands along with it. A lot of times you will see players personalize their arm bands, like Allen Iverson who has his nickname "The Answer" written across it. Wrist bands usually run for $8 US for a pair.

Basketball Accessories - Rubber Bracelets

An NBA player wearing a rubber bracelet. The rubber bracelet became fashionable when Lance Armstrong introduced those cool Live Strong Bracelets. Now they have become stylish on the b-ball courts too. On any NBA team, you will find at least three or four players who are wearing rubber bracelets. Usually they are bracelets that match the team uniform and sometimes they have a message inscribed in them. Most major shoe companies sell these rubber bracelets that come in packs of three and retail for about $10 US.

Basketball Accessories - Sack Packs

A sack pack by Brand Jordan. Sack packs are the latest rage for ballers especially in New York City. These cheap and fasionable sack packs are good substitutes for backpacks. Sack packs fit your kicks and are a styling way to arrive and leave the court. Companies such as Brand Jordan, Adidas and Nike sell these sack packs for $15 US and under.
